Uzbekneftegaz to accelerate commissioning of new wells to stabilize gas production

TASHKENT. Sept 15 (Interfax) - JSC Uzbekneftegaz intends to strengthen work on stabilizing gas production and accelerate the commissioning of new wells as part of preparations for the autumn-winter season, the company said.

At a meeting chaired by the head of Uzbekneftegaz, Abdugani Sanginov, production indicators and measures to ensure a stable supply of natural gas to consumers in the autumn-winter period were considered. It was noted that a significant amount of work has been carried out to maintain stable production since the beginning of the year. However, it was emphasized that despite the availability of reserves and financial resources for this, indicators in some areas do not meet expectations.

Sanginov gave instructions to focus attention on work directly at the fields and wells, as well as to increase specialists' responsibility for production results.

At the meeting, tasks were set for developing deep wells, working with the existing well stock, accelerating drilling and commissioning of new wells as part of projects with foreign partners, and organizing commercial gas production from wells in the border zone.

Separate instructions were given to control the supply of small compressor stations, prepare sites in advance and accelerate earthworks at the M-25 field.

The results of reforms at the joint venture Gissarneftegaz (Uzbekneftegaz owns 65%, Switzerland's Gas Project Development Central Asia AG owns 45%) were also considered. It was noted that oil and gas condensate production doubled. At the same time, fulfillment of the production plan was only 61% in January-August. The task was set to raise this indicator to at least 90% by the end of the year.

In addition, instructions were issued concerning the commissioning of new wells in the second half of September, maintaining a stable flow rate of existing wells, full utilization of production capacities and preventing emergency shutdowns.
